Overall Meaning

The lyrics to Provision's song Someone Like You depict a person who is dealing with feelings of loneliness and isolation, likely due to a relationship that has ended. The line "penetrated by chemicals" suggests that the person may be self-medicating with drugs or alcohol to help them cope with their emotional pain. Despite this, the person's words seem to fall on deaf ears, as they are no longer interesting to whoever they are speaking to.


The chorus of the song speaks directly to the person who has caused the singer's pain, questioning what they will do now that they have pushed the singer away. The singer makes it clear that there is no sympathy for the person and that they will have to face the consequences of their actions. The line "your replacement was easier than healing" suggests that the person may have moved on quickly to another relationship, rather than dealing with the emotional fallout of the previous one.


In the final verse, the singer reflects on their own journey of healing and growth, taking pride in how far they have come despite the pain they have endured. The line "an eternity of suffering" speaks to the intense and long-lasting impact that heartbreak can have on a person, but the singer shows resilience in their determination to move forward.


Overall, the song speaks to the complexities of human relationships and the pain that can be caused when those connections are severed. It also highlights the importance of self-care and resilience in the face of hardship.
